Differing types of Thinner
There are several differing kinds of thinner available, each with its own specific properties and uses. The commonest different types of thinner involve mineral spirits, acetone, turpentine, and xylene. Mineral spirits, often called white spirits, certainly are a petroleum-dependent solvent usually used as being a paint thinner and degreaser. Acetone is a robust solvent that is usually utilized for cleaning and degreasing surfaces, in addition to for thinning certain varieties of paint and coatings. Turpentine is really a natural solvent derived from pine trees and is usually employed as a thinner for oil-centered paints and coatings. Xylene can be a extremely multipurpose solvent that is usually used in the printing, rubber, and leather-based industries, along with for thinning paints and coatings.

The best way to Use Thinner Securely
When utilizing thinner, it is vital to consider correct protection safety measures to shield yourself and Other individuals from opportunity hazards. Thinner is a unstable chemical that may be dangerous if inhaled or if it will come into contact with the skin or eyes. It can be crucial to implement thinner in the nicely-ventilated space to forestall the buildup of fumes, and to have on acceptable private protecting tools including gloves, goggles, and a respirator. It is usually crucial that you avoid smoking cigarettes or utilizing open up flames when using thinner, since it is very flammable.
Together with having appropriate protection precautions, it is crucial to follow the producer's Guidance when utilizing thinner. This involves using the correct form of thinner for the precise application, and also pursuing the recommended mixing ratios and application strategies. It is additionally important to correctly get rid of any leftover thinner or contaminated materials In line with community polices.

Environmental Impression of Thinner
Thinner may have a significant environmental effects if not utilized and disposed of thoroughly. Quite a few varieties of thinner are volatile organic and natural compounds (VOCs) that may add to air pollution if produced to the atmosphere. On top of that, some forms of thinner can contaminate soil and water if not disposed of thoroughly. It is necessary to make use of thinner in a very effectively-ventilated space to stop the buildup of fumes, also to correctly eliminate any leftover thinner or contaminated supplies As outlined by area polices.
Possibilities to Thinner
There are numerous solutions to applying common solvents which include thinner that are safer for each human well being plus the surroundings. Drinking water-dependent solvents are getting to be significantly popular as an alternative to standard solvents for example mineral spirits or acetone. These solvents are a lot less poisonous than regular solvents and possess decreased amounts of VOCs, building them safer for both equally human health and fitness as well as ecosystem. On top of that, There's also bio-primarily based solvents offered which might be derived from renewable assets including plants or agricultural by-products.
